Roundworms are some of the most common intestinal worms in dogs. There are two types of roundworms in dogs: Toxocara canis (T. canis) and Toxascaris leonina.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Yunnan Baiyao for dogs is one of the best-known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) herbal supplements. Many veterinarians use it to control bleeding in emergency situations, so it has earned a place in the treatment of dogs with certain types of cancer, such as hemangiosarcoma. WebApr 10, 2024 · Average Costs of Cat Intestinal Blockage Surgery. Based on various anecdotal reports and online forums, the cost of cat intestinal blockage surgery can range anywhere from $1,000 to over $7,000. However, most pet owners report spending between $2,000 and $4,000 for the surgery and associated expenses.
